Here's how you can effectively design data visualizations for diverse target audiences.
Crafting data visualizations that resonate with a wide range of audiences is an art and a science. You need to consider not only the information you're presenting but also how different people will understand and interpret it. Whether you're a seasoned data analyst or just starting out, the key to effective communication lies in tailoring your visualizations to meet the needs and expectations of your audience. This means going beyond the mere presentation of data to create a narrative that engages and informs. Let's explore how you can achieve this balance and ensure your visualizations are as inclusive as they are insightful.
